Get started11 Ranelagh Street is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Hereford (HR4 0DT). It has a recorded floor area of 180 m² (around 1938 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(October 2013) shows an E (score 42),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would push it to D (score 65). The latest certificate is from October 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a basement. Period features are noted in the property record.
Held since August 2004 — that's 22 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 20%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£378,000 is 40.5% above the 2004 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£139/sq ft) was about 27.4% below the postcode norm. At 180 m² the property is well over the postcode median (117 m² across 18 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ock.
